Career Path
Career Roles in Immigration Law Immigration Consultant: Professionals providing advice on immigration processes and legal requirements, essential for navigating complex regulations.
Consular Officer: Representatives working in embassies, responsible for visa processing and advising foreign nationals on immigration matters.
Legal Advisor: Experts in immigration law who offer legal counsel to clients, helping them understand their rights and options.
Compliance Officer: Individuals ensuring that organizations adhere to immigration laws and regulations, crucial for maintaining legal standards.
Policy Analyst: Analysts researching and developing policies related to immigration law, influencing legislative changes and practices.
